It is in good condition, dated February 1948, unframed, and will be shipped from New York. Xavier Amiama was born in Santo Domingo in the Dominican Republic in 1910 and died in Haiti in 1969. After numerous single artist shows in Santo Domingo, Amiama settled in Port au Prince, Haiti, in 1936 to teach painting. He encouraged Ption Savain
